Currently, video storage is not a single medium but a complex multi-tiered hot and cold storage architecture (Tiered Storage Architecture). A. Architecture Components 1. Ultra-Hot Tier: Used to handle instantaneous traffic bursts (like videos just released by top influencers). • Type: NVMe SSD clusters + memory-level caching (Redis/Memcached). • Core Metrics: **IOPS (Input/Output Operations Per Second)** and extremely low latency. 2. Warm Tier: Used to store videos that are actively watched daily. • Type: High-performance enterprise-grade HDDs or large-capacity QLC SSDs. • Core Metrics: Balancing throughput and cost. 3. Cold/Archive Tier: Used to store long-tail videos from years ago that are hardly viewed. • Type: High-density helium HDDs or even physically isolated tape drives. • Core Metrics: Total Cost of Ownership (TCO) per TB.
